    I don't think there's a practical way of stopping EVERY piece of spam from getting by. But maybe, one or more of the following could be done:
    1. Instead of requiring approval for a users FIRST post, how about having a mandatory time limit between a users first and second post. A 30 second wait might not be unreasonable, but might stop, or at least slow down a bot. That could be relaxed for people who have been members on the site for longer
    2. Maybe there could be some kind of automated spam detection to detect duplicate sequential postings by the same user.

    This would work but the truth is except that one wave which prompted this thread, it's pretty much always 1 spam post per user. Regular members can't see it but for every spam message that makes it to users there are like 30 that get caught in our spam filter.
